Our commitment to the environment
We care for these grounds with the long view in mind. Our staff are trained in horticulture and work with natural, ecological approaches — nurturing the pond, tending the landscape, and letting the gardens thrive quietly. We've moved to electric vehicles and equipment, and we reclaim grave sites where we can, so these green spaces can continue to grow and breathe for generations to come.
